Aides for computer work

I’m about to start writing my second book. As I finished recording the first one my vision was declining. Now I’m at the point where with 28pt Bold type I can see the words, but cannot navigate the commands at the top of the page for “insert” or “print” etc. Took my laptop to a store to try large monitors, but while the page itself was huge, the command selections are not enlarged. Any ideas of what I can do? Thanks.

  1. Hi . Have you tried using a magnifying glass to see the commands? This article also has some great ideas, including an option on Microsoft Windows that allows you to make everything bigger, not just the font: https://maculardegeneration.net/living/windows-accessibility. I hope this helps and that you succeed in getting your second book out into the world. - Lori (Team Member)
